Acil yardım lütfen PHP

badyguard14 mert kaan

<?
include("baglan.php");
mysql_query("SET NAMES 'utf8'");
$k=$_GET['anim'];
$tani=$k."-tanitim";
if($k==""){
echo "Veri yok"; }
else {
$tanim=mysql_query("SELECT * FROM bolum WHERE link LIKE '%$tani%'");
$tanit=mysql_fetch_array($tanim);
echo '<a href="sayfa.php?anim='.$tanit['link'].'" target="gos">'.$tanit['baslik'].'</a></br>';
$sor=mysql_query("SELECT * FROM bolum WHERE link LIKE '%$k%' order by link asc");
$say=0;
while($y=mysql_fetch_array($sor)){
$say++;
$link=$y["link"];

echo '<a href="sayfa.php?anim='.$link.'" target="gos">'.$y['baslik'].'</a></br> ';
}
}
?>

Arkadaşlar şöyle bir sorunum var şimdi de ; veritabanında arama yaptırıp çıkan sonuçları alfabetik olarak listeletiyorum.Ama veriler içinde birde tanıtım var.Ben bunu almasını istemiyorum.Veriler şu şekilde:
Fortune-arterial-tanitim
Fortune-arterial-1
Fortune-arterial-2    bu şekilde sıralı listeletince tanıtım en sonda çıkıyor.Ben başta çıkmasını istiyorum ya da tanıtım içeren çıkmasın.Yardımcı olacak arkadaşlara teşekkür ederim.

 

12-07-2011 18:37

    Php

    eğer ID gibi bir sayı atadıysan. ORDER BY id DESC şeklinde tersten sıralarsın.

    Her programcı birgün Php yi tadacaktır
    12-07-2011 21:53

      Php

      badyguard14 mert kaan

      hocam o zamanda diziliş şu şekilde çıkacaktır 
      tanıtım
      2
      1

      şeklinde oluşur ben tanıtım başta olmak şartıyla
      tanıtım
      1
      2

      şeklinde sıralama yapmam lazım yada arattıktan sonra tanıtım olanı hiç sıraya eklemesin nasıl olur? 

       

      12-07-2011 22:01

        www.Phpkodlari.com © 2009 Herkes Php öğrenecek
        Web tasarım ve eğitim kaynağınız.